Public benefits
PURPOSE 1: The Advancement of Education: The direct benefits flowing from this purpose include the provision of programmes and facilities for the enhanced development and education of children up to the age of seventeen and the encouragement of parents and guardians to understand and provide for the needs of their children in order to promote the
physiological, natural, social and other aspects of family children and young people’s education. These benefits will be demonstrated by recording the numbers of people who access our services and measuring these against the targets established our annual action plan. There is no harm that be discerned as flowing from this purpose. The beneficiaries are the people of the Ballymagroarty, Hazelbank, Coshquin, Glen, Rosemount and City area of Co Derry and its environs.
... [more] [less]What your organisation does
To achieve our purposes to advance education the Centre will work with the other voluntary, community, business and statutory organisations in the Outer West Neighbourhood Renewal Partnership to deliver a range of programmes, services and facilities, including capacity building, classes, training, social events and a range of healthy life-style
opportunities such as health awareness sessions, physical activity sessions.
